I'm trying to set up an extension for a new game where mods are stored as zips. I followed the instructions here https://wiki.nexusmods.com/index.php/Creating_a_game_extension_for_Vortex#Mod_installation_patterns while replacing the .PAK with .zip.

 

I have basically no experience with javascript but I can't find anything that should be making the files get unzipped. I assume that somewhere there's something that automatically unpacks zips, if someone could let me know how to stop that from happening I would really appreciate it.

Hey Endur1el,

 

If you give Vortex an archive (zip/rar/7z/etc) it will automatically unpack it and send those unpacked files through the installer. Currently, leaving mods packed as not an option. The only game I know of where this is a thing is Farming Simulator. In these cases I have suggested that the authors "double zip" their mods to ensure they're not extracted.

 

It is possible to repack the archive as part of the installer, but that's fairly complex (and not particularly resource friendly as you're just unpacking files to repack them again).
